package jsp.java.jsp.model.util;

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;

import jsp.java.jsp.model.User;



public class Mysql {
	
	private static final String url = "jdbc:mysql://localhost:3306/lol";
	private static final String user = "root";
	private static final String password = "root";
	
	private static Connection creatConnection() throws ClassNotFoundException,SQLException{
		Class.forName("com.mysql.jdbc.Driver");
		Connection conn = DriverManager.getConnection(url,user,password);
		return conn;
	}
	
	public static User getUserRole(String username) throws Exception{
		Connection conn = creatConnection();
		String sql = "select password,role from users where username=?";
		PreparedStatement ps = conn.prepareStatement(sql);
		ps.setString(1, username);
		ResultSet rs = ps.executeQuery();
		User u = new User();
		while(rs.next()){
			u.setRole(rs.getString("role"));
			u.setPassword(rs.getString("password"));
		}
		rs.close();
		ps.close();
		conn.close();
		return u;
	}

}
最近下载更多
林守汐  LV2 2024年6月21日
微信网友_6829521472425984  LV5 2024年1月20日
Crayonxin  LV1 2023年12月14日
ATOMBOMMM  LV1 2023年12月3日
王瑞峰  LV2 2023年7月18日
000666  LV10 2022年12月24日
1358849392  LV21 2022年11月11日
二郎滩的大帅  LV3 2022年9月15日
cxdxfx12  LV14 2022年6月19日
yyds123456  LV2 2022年5月26日
最近浏览更多
小小123 1月9日
暂无贡献等级
1708099240  LV1 2024年9月25日
林守汐  LV2 2024年6月21日
23120450  LV1 2024年6月18日
Jim_joker  LV1 2024年4月25日
tartaglia  LV2 2024年4月16日
linxh123456 2024年3月10日
暂无贡献等级
微信网友_6829521472425984  LV5 2024年1月20日
GJQ123  LV4 2023年12月29日
Crayonxin  LV1 2023年12月14日
顶部 客服 微信二维码 底部
>扫描二维码关注最代码为好友扫描二维码关注最代码为好友